Hannah Halbert, Executive Director of Policy Matters Ohio, joined the America's Work Force Union Podcast to discuss Ohio's scrapped fair school funding plan, the implications of prioritizing stadium funding over education and the potential impact on local communities.

The Fair School Funding Plan was a bipartisan effort to address Ohio's unconstitutional school funding system. Halbert explained that the plan aimed to calculate the actual cost of educating students based on their needs, ensuring equitable distribution of resources across school districts. This approach would prevent disparities between wealthy and poorer communities, providing every child with a constitutionally adequate education. However, the plan is now being dismantled, with lawmakers citing unsustainability as the reason, despite its critical importance for future prosperity.

Halbert highlighted the troubling prioritization of stadium funding over education. She pointed out that while the state claims it cannot afford the $3 billion needed for schools, it has proposed allocating significant funds for stadium projects. If approved by the state legislature, it would reflect a backward set of priorities, as stadiums historically do not generate the promised economic benefits. In contrast, investing in education is crucial for long-term prosperity, as it develops a well-educated workforce that attracts businesses and fosters innovation, Halbert said.

The impact of these funding decisions extends to local communities, where the burden of school funding may shift to local taxpayers. Halbert noted that as state support dwindles, communities might face increased pressure to pass local levies to fund their schools. This shift in responsibility could lead to further inequities, as wealthier areas may be better equipped to support their schools than poorer ones. Halbert urged Ohioans to engage with their lawmakers and advocate for fair school funding to ensure all children receive the education they deserve.
